With the March 1 deadline for implementing $85 billion in federal government spending cuts for the remainder of fiscal year 2013 under the so-called sequester fast approaching, the U.S. Department of Agriculture and the Food and Drug Administration suggested they may have to reduce food inspections. In the case of the U.S.D.A.s Food Safety Inspection Service, a furlough of part of the meat inspection workforce may force meat processing plants to curtail operations.
